Output 6d6bd6376896b2ea8d1710c822c78fa6e76f8a75b26a47b73d30ca5f5bfd64e9:0

value
839447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017d5f26616cea61f7143546142b1e815fa4e2b3 OP_EQUAL
address
31ptniHNxT88NWG5eRwPoqAiGobm7DyUu1
transaction
6d6bd6376896b2ea8d1710c822c78fa6e76f8a75b26a47b73d30ca5f5bfd64e9
confirmations
270789
spent
true